I have a simpler setup to turn when out in our class A motorhome. A Jet 1015VS that clamps on a Workmate. A second table that holds a box of drawers for all the small stuff. Two tank mechanics bags with my Easy Wood Tools, and plastic boxes of pen kits, etc. it is fun to turn outside here in Colorado. I always get people who come by to watch and talk.
